Black Sabbath's Tony Iommi diagnosed with lymphoma





According to a statement from Black Sabbath, guitarist Tony Iommi has been diagnosed with the early stages of lymphoma. The statement asks fans to send good vibes to the guitiarist, who is currently working with doctors to determine the best treatment plan and remains “upbeat and determined to make a full and successful recovery.” 


This news comes only months after the group announced their plans to record their first album in 33 years and tour behind it in 2012. The band’s statement does not say whether or not the tour will be affected by Iommi’s condition, but does mention that the band will travel to the UK to continue to work with Iommi.
